NESREA Probes Suspected Chemical Spill On Kaduna–Abuja Expressway

The National Environmental Standards and Regulations Enforcement Agency (NESREA) has launched an investigation into a suspected chemical spill following a truck accident on the Kaduna–Abuja Expressway.

According to a statement issued yesterday by the agency’s assistant director of Press, Mrs Nwamaka Ejiofor, the accident left behind a white, foamy substance at the scene, prompting an immediate response from environmental authorities.

A team from NESREA’s Kaduna State Field Office, led by the state coordinator, Mr Hena Emmanuel, visited the site to commence investigations.

The team met with the Jere police commander, Assistant Commissioner of Police Sani Zubairu, the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) commander in the area, and the community leader.

Preliminary findings indicate that a heavy-duty truck was involved in the accident, resulting in the spillage of its contents. NESREA said it gathered information from security agencies, relevant officials and residents to support its investigation.

The agency also collected samples of the foamy substance, surrounding soil and water from a nearby stream for laboratory analysis to determine the nature of the material and assess its potential environmental impact.

NESREA advised members of the public to avoid contact with the foamy substance, nearby water sources and the surrounding soil until the investigation is concluded. The agency said the precautionary measure is necessary to prevent possible exposure to hazardous materials.
